A contractor moves from one contract company to another triggers which concept?

Explanation:
This item examines what happens to a vetted status when a contractor switches employers. When a contractor moves from one contract company to another, the appropriate mechanism is Transfer of Trust. The trust decision is tied to the individual, not to a single employer, so the new contractor organization can rely on the existing vetted status rather than starting the entire background investigation from scratch. This keeps access and work flowing smoothly while maintaining security by ensuring the individual’s trustworthiness is still recognized by the new employer. Upgrade escalation would be about granting higher levels of access or authority as duties increase, not about transferring the already established trust. RoT re-check implies a re-check under a specific trigger, which isn’t the standard response to a change in employer. Trust renewal would suggest a fresh renewal process at a set interval, which isn’t required simply because the contractor changed companies. The Transfer of Trust approach best fits the scenario.
